High blood pressure alcohol: mechanisms and health risksHypertension medical arterial hypertension referred to, is an important health Problem that is associated with a variety of cardiovascular diseases. One of the known factors of influence on the blood pressure of the regular consumption of alcohol.Physiological Mechanisms Of ActionAlcohol affects blood pressure via multiple physiological pathways:Sympathetic Nervous System. Alcohol stimulates the sympathetic nervous system, which leads to a release of adrenaline and noradrenaline. These hormones cause a narrowing of the blood vessels (vasoconstriction) and an increase in heart rate, which increases blood pressure.Renin‑Angiotensin‑aldosterone‑System (RAAS). Long-term alcohol consumption can affect the activity of the RAAS. This System plays a Central role in the Regulation of blood volume and blood pressure. Overactivation leads to increased water and Salt retention in the kidney, what is the blood volume and thus blood pressure increases.Endothelial function. Alcohol can impair the function of the vascular endothelium. The endothelium normally produces substances such as nitric oxide (NO), which is for the relaxation of the vascular musculature. A dysfunction leads to decreased vasodilation, and thus to increased blood pressure.Potassium and magnesium loss. Alcohol is a diuretic, which leads substances to an increased elimination of minerals such as potassium and Magnesium. A deficiency of these electrolytes may contribute to increased vascular tension, and heart rhythm disorders.Epidemiological FindingsNumerous studies show a clear relationship between daily alcohol consumption and the Occurrence of hypertension. According to the WHO recommendations, the daily consumption should remain at maximum of 20 g of pure alcohol for women and 30 g for men is limited. You exceed these limits regularly, increases the risk of hypertension significantly.A prospective cohort study with over 50,000 participants, showed that people who consumed more than 30 g of alcohol, had a 40% increased risk for hypertension compared to non-drinkers or occasional users.Long-term consequencesA permanently elevated blood pressure due to use of alcohol leads to the following complications:Heart failure,Stroke,Kidney damageVascular Calcification (Atherosclerosis),The back of the eye changes.Prevention and treatment approachesThe reduction or complete cessation of alcohol consumption is an important measure to reduce blood pressure. Clinical studies have shown that even a moderate reduction of alcohol consumption by 50% can lead to a reduction of the systolic blood pressure by 3-4 mmHg.In addition, the following measures should be taken:a healthy diet (rich in potassium, Magnesium, dietary fiber),regular physical activity,Weight reduction in Overweight,Reduction of salt consumption,drug blood pressure reduction in the required indication.ConclusionThe regular and excessive consumption of alcohol is a significant risk factor for the development of hypertension. The influence of various physiological systems leads to a permanent increase in blood pressure and increased disease risk for serious cardiovascular.
